The cheapest way to get from Reagan Washington Airport (DCA) to Eden Center is to drive which costs $1 - $3 and takes 14 min.
The fastest way to get from Reagan Washington Airport (DCA) to Eden Center is to taxi which takes 14 min and costs $28 - $35.
No, there is no direct bus from Reagan Washington Airport (DCA) to Eden Center. However, there are services departing from King Street-Old Town+Bay C and arriving at Roosevelt Bl+Wilson Bl via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 11m.
No, there is no direct train from Reagan Washington Airport (DCA) to Eden Center. However, there are services departing from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port, Yellow/Blue Line Track 1 Platform-Trains North Washington DC & Maryland Via Virginia and arriving at East Falls Church, Orange/Silver Line Center Platform via Rosslyn, Blue/Orange/Silver Track 2 Platform.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 43 min.
The distance between Reagan Washington Airport (DCA) and Eden Center is 10 miles. The road distance is 9 miles.
The best way to get from Reagan Washington Airport (DCA) to Eden Center without a car is to subway which takes 43 min and costs $4 - $6.
It takes approximately 43 min to get from Reagan Washington Airport (DCA) to Eden Center, including transfers.

You can take a subway from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port, Yellow/Blue Line Track 1 Platform-Trains North Washington DC & Maryland Via Virginia to Eden Center via Rosslyn, Blue/Orange/Silver Track 2 Platform and East Falls Church, Orange/Silver Line Center Platform in around 43 min. Alternatively, Washington Metropolitan Area Transit Authority operates a bus from King Street-Old Town+Bay C to Roosevelt Bl+Wilson Bl every 15 minutes. Tickets cost $3 and the journey takes 53 min.
